H-D Smart Security System (Optional)
The factory installed next-generation security system features a hands-free fob that automatically arms and disarms the vehicle electronic security functions as you approach and walk away from the bike. Stick the fob on your ignition key ring and let it do all the work. It's this attention to detail and security that make Harley-Davidson motorcycles unique.
Adjustable Cigar Tube Rear Shocks
The classic-style suspension covers may add to the Switchback's vintage Harley-Davidson style, but the modern technology they re wrapped around delivers a ride that feels anything but old school. Oil emulsion damping control gives a smooth, quality ride that makes it easy to go the distance. And preload can be adjusted with just a spanner wrench, so you can easily switch your suspension to suit your riding style, touring or cruising.

US Motorcycle Sales First Half 2011 Results

Thu, 28 Jul 2011

The U.S. motorcycle industry saw a 4.6% decrease in year-on-year sales over the first six months of 2011, thanks mostly to a 17.3% drop in ATV sales. Motorcycle and scooter sales however saw a 1.7% bump in the first half .

Forbes Expects Harley-Davidson to Announce Gains for Q3 2011

Mon, 17 Oct 2011

In anticipation of Harley-Davidson announcing its third-quarter performance in 2011 Forbes.com expects Harley will reveal its third straight quarter of sales growth. The article says that financial analysts expect “earnings of $0.76 per share, up 47.4% from the same quarter of last year.” Additionally, an 18.8% gain in revenues is expected.
